ubuntu

如何在Ubuntu上优化LNMP数据库

小樊
43
2025-05-15 17:29:06
栏目: 智能运维

在Ubuntu上优化LNMP(Linux, Nginx, MySQL/MariaDB, PHP)数据库可以通过以下几种方法:

升级软件版本

确保使用的是最新版本的Nginx、MySQL和PHP,因为新版本通常会包含性能改进和bug修复。

调整服务器参数

使用缓存

使用Varnish、Memcached、Redis等缓存技术来减轻服务器负载,提高网站性能。

启用Gzip压缩

在Nginx配置中启用Gzip压缩,减少传输数据量,加快网站加载速度。

使用CDN(内容分发网络)

将静态资源如图片、CSS、JavaScript文件等放在CDN上,减轻服务器负载,加快页面加载速度。

精简和优化代码

优化网站代码,减少不必要的查询和请求,提高网站响应速度。

监控和调整

定期监控服务器的性能指标,如CPU使用率、内存占用率、网络流量等,根据监控结果调整服务器配置和优化性能。

启用HTTP/2

启用HTTP/2协议以提高网站的加载速度和性能。

启用PHP缓存

启用PHP缓存如OPcache或APC来加速PHP脚本执行。

优化数据库

定期清理和优化MySQL数据库,删除不必要的数据、索引和查询语句。

通过以上措施,可以在Ubuntu上优化LNMP的性能,提高网站的响应速度和用户体验。

0
看了该问题的人还看了